- Our campus -- It is rare to find a campus with 14 acres of green: grass, trees, creek, and a pond that draws wild birds. Teachers integrate our environment into students' lessons by: going on nature hikes, learning about the parts of the leaf, making art with what they find on hikes, arranging wildflowers, learning about the lifecycle of the salmon, learning about migratory birds, and so on. A cornerstone of the Montessori philosophy is hands on learning, and we have the campus for that!
- Our academics -- We have great teachers; they are Montessori-trained, and bring their own gifts and passions to their classrooms. Using the Montessori method and a low teacher:student ratio, students get the help they need to succeed. Whether you have a child that can fly through academics, a child who struggles in an area and needs one-on-one help to get past stumbling blocks, or anywhere in between, each student can rise to his or her highest potential in each subject through the Montessori method and the help of our amazing teachers.
- Our Montessori Teacher Education Program -- We train Montessori teachers at the Early Childhood (2½ - 6 years) and Elementary (6 - 12 years) levels for Private and Public Montessori schools. Our program is accredited by MACTE (Montessori Accreditation Council for Teacher Education).
